1. A researcher is studying the resting membrane potential of a giant axon. Which ion
distribution is primarily responsible for maintaining the interior negative charge relative to
the exterior during the resting state?

A. High concentration of sodium ions inside and high concentration of potassium ions outside
B. High concentration of potassium ions inside and high concentration of sodium ions outside
C. Equal distribution of chloride and calcium ions across the membrane
D. High concentration of organic anions outside and calcium ions inside

Correct Answer: B. High concentration of potassium ions inside and high concentration of
sodium ions outside

Rationale: The resting membrane potential is largely established by the sodium-potassium
pump and the selective permeability of the membrane to potassium ions, creating a high
intracellular potassium concentration and a high extracellular sodium concentration. Option
A reverses these concentrations. Options C and D do not reflect the primary ionic gradient
responsible for the resting negative charge.

2. During an action potential, which event causes the rapid depolarization phase of the
neuronal membrane?

A. Efflux of potassium ions through voltage-gated channels
B. Influx of sodium ions through voltage-gated channels
C. Closure of sodium-potassium pumps
D. Influx of chloride ions through ligand-gated channels

Correct Answer: B. Influx of sodium ions through voltage-gated channels

Rationale: Depolarization occurs when voltage-gated sodium channels open in response to
threshold stimulation, allowing sodium ions to rush into the cell down their electrochemical
gradient. Option A describes repolarization, while options C and D do not drive the rapid
depolarization phase.

3. A patient presents with a focal neurological deficit resulting from a stroke affecting the
primary motor cortex. Which anatomical landmark separates the motor cortex from the
somatosensory cortex?

A. Lateral sulcus
B. Longitudinal fissure
C. Central sulcus

,D. Parieto-occipital sulcus

Correct Answer: C. Central sulcus

Rationale: The central sulcus is the prominent anatomical landmark that separates the frontal
lobe (containing the primary motor cortex) from the parietal lobe (containing the primary
somatosensory cortex). Option A separates the temporal lobe from the frontal and parietal
lobes, while option B divides the two cerebral hemispheres.

4. Which neuroglial cell is primarily responsible for myelin formation in the central
nervous system?

A. Schwann cell
B. Microglia
C. Astrocyte
D. Oligodendrocyte

Correct Answer: D. Oligodendrocyte

Rationale: Oligodendrocytes myelinate axons in the central nervous system, whereas Schwann
cells perform this function in the peripheral nervous system. Astrocytes provide metabolic
support and maintain the blood-brain barrier, and microglia act as resident immune cells.

5. A neuropharmacologist is analyzing a drug that blocks monoamine oxidase (MAO).
What is the direct net physiological effect of this inhibition on synaptic transmission?

A. Decreased synthesis of acetylcholine in the presynaptic terminal
B. Increased concentration of neurotransmitters such as serotonin and norepinephrine within the synaptic
cleft
C. Immediate degradation of postsynaptic receptor sites
D. Accelerated reuptake of dopamine into the presynaptic neuron

Correct Answer: B. Increased concentration of neurotransmitters such as serotonin and
norepinephrine within the synaptic cleft

Rationale: Monoamine oxidase is the enzyme responsible for breaking down monoamine
neurotransmitters. Inhibiting MAO prevents their enzymatic degradation, leaving more
neurotransmitters available in the terminal and increasing their release into the synaptic cleft.
The other options do not describe the action of MAO inhibitors.

6. Damage to Broca's area, located in the inferior frontal gyrus of the dominant
hemisphere, typically results in which clinical presentation?

A. Fluent speech with impaired comprehension and nonsensical words
B. Non-fluent, halting speech with preserved comprehension and impaired repetition
C. Complete inability to recognize familiar faces or objects
D. Inability to execute learned motor acts despite intact muscle strength

, Correct Answer: B. Non-fluent, halting speech with preserved comprehension and impaired
repetition

Rationale: Broca's aphasia is characterized by expressive difficulties resulting in non-fluent,
labored speech, whereas speech comprehension remains relatively intact. Option A describes
Wernicke's aphasia, which involves fluent speech with poor comprehension.

7. Which structure acts as the primary sensory relay station for the brain, processing and
directing information to the appropriate cortical areas?

A. Hypothalamus
B. Thalamus
C. Amygdala
D. Hippocampus

Correct Answer: B. Thalamus

Rationale: The thalamus serves as the main relay and integration center for sensory
information (excluding olfaction) heading toward the cerebral cortex. Option A regulates
autonomic and endocrine functions, option C handles emotional processing, and option D is
critical for memory consolidation.

8. In a classical conditioning experiment, an animal learns to associate a tone with a mild
foot shock. Which brain structure is critically necessary for the acquisition and expression
of this conditioned fear response?

A. Cerebellum
B. Basal ganglia
C. Amygdala
D. Suprachiasmatic nucleus

Correct Answer: C. Amygdala

Rationale: The amygdala, particularly the basolateral and central nuclei, plays a central role
in processing emotional valence and is essential for classical fear conditioning. Option A is
involved in motor learning and coordination, and option D regulates circadian rhythms.
